The perfect loaded Cobb salad πŸ₯— In partnership with the Mushroom Council, I’m showing how crispy mushrooms bring a savory, umami punch to level up a plant-based Cobb.

Fresh veggies, creamy avocado, and my tofu ranch dressingβ€”and you’ve got a bowl that fuels the hustle. Share this with your salad-obsessed friends and level up your Cobb game ⬇

  • 1⃣ Preheat the oven to 450Β°F. Line a r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per. Arrange the tempeh (8 oz) and mushrooms (3.5 oz container) on the baking sheet.

  • 2⃣ In a small bowl, whisk together 3 tablespoons coconut aminos, 2 tablespoons vegetable oil, and Β½ teaspoon liquid smoke (if using). Spoon over the tempeh and mushrooms and toss to coat.

  • 3⃣ Bake until the mushrooms are crisp and browned and the tempeh is charred around the edges, 10–15 minutes, rotating the baking sheet halfway through. Finish with a pinch of salt and a few cracks of black pepper.

  • 4⃣ Build your salad: start with 4 cups spinach, then add black beans, tomatoes, corn, carrots, cucumbers, onion, and avocado. Top with the mushrooms and tempeh, then drizzle generously with tofu ranch dressing.

Small swaps make a big difference πŸ”„ The sun’s coming out, schedules are filling up, and it’s easy for the days to start feeling a little chaotic. When that happens, I come back to the basics: movement, fuel, mindset, and protecting my energy. If you’re in that same space, here are a few easy swaps that make a big difference:

  • A quick walk instead of scrolling πŸ‘Ÿ 10-minute break between calls? Take a lap around the block instead of reaching for your phone. Instant refresh.

  • Meal prep instead of takeout πŸ₯— I carve out time on Sunday to prep a few proteins and veggies for the week. It makes the healthy choice the easy choice when things get busy later.

  • Starting the day with intention instead of reaction β˜€ Wake up a little earlier than you need to (when you can… I know it can be hard with little kids). Read, journal, or move before opening your inbox. It shifts the tone of your entire day.

  • Earlier wind-down instead of late-night TV πŸ› Even 15–20 minutes earlier makes a difference. Better sleep = better everything.

  • Prep the night before instead of rushing in the morning 🧳 Outfit, bag, mealsβ€”setting it up ahead of time makes mornings feel calmer and more in control.

Question: What Ninja Creami recipes do you use?

- Shelby
❝

Answer: I keep it super simple. My go-to is freezing a plant-based protein shake and mixing in some berriesβ€”usually gets me 20g+ of protein and feels like dessert.
